Service Care Solutions are currently recruiting a Family Support Worker on behalf of Oldham Council's Short break Children with disability service.


As a Family Support Worker you will work directly with children, young people and families, providing practical help, advice and guidance on issues affecting family, relationship and functioning especially in areas relating to child's additional needs.

This will include assessment visits and direct work with family support tasks at families homes.


The role involves working with colleagues from all agencies to ensure effective service delivery, promoting coordinated integrated working for the best outcomes for the child/young person and their families.
